Bouquet Of Prayers
Some of the locals are ‘into' spiritualist mediums and have on occasions invited people to come to ‘sessions' in each other's homes.
At the Friday Drop In one of the young Mums mentioned this (she had hosted one of the medium sessions) to me, she asked my opinion about it, which led to an interesting conversation. I was about to go into the Chapel to do the reflection and I asked her if she would like to come.
She came along and joined in with all the responses, the reflection was a bouquet of prayer, each person was asked to take a flower, think of a person, place, situation that may need prayer, then as you name them, place the flower in the oasis. A beautiful bouquet of prayer was created. The young Mum was so moved by this and said she would never be able to put flowers in a vase again without thinking/praying for someone. There was such a blanket of peace came over us.
